    Just got my Blackberry Curve and the battery is low. My LED is flashing both red AND green at the same time. I asked a couple of people and they say that it's supposed to be just green when the battery is low.
    Nope nothing wrong with your berry Its supposed to be like that, a yellow-ish sort of colour when the battery is low. It will flash green if you turn on the coverage indication in Options > Screen/Keyboard.

    Hey guys...great advice and thanks. But maybe I didn't explain it well. It is distinctly both red and green only. It's almost like it's a green light but with a red dot on the side.
    Yes, at the same time right? That is the low battery indication. RIM describes it as being yellow, but its more orange-ish. Charge your phone and it will go away.
